


Paris Theater
$29.00
Ready to ship!
18 mesh
2.5 × 2
Canvas will arrives taped and include a needle.
Quantity:
Add To Cart
Ready to ship!
18 mesh
2.5 × 2
Canvas will arrives taped and include a needle.
Ready to ship!
18 mesh
2.5 × 2
Canvas will arrives taped and include a needle.